Konstantīns Beņkovskis is a scholar working on General Economics, Econometrics and Finance, Strategy and Management and Economics and Econometrics. According to data from OpenAlex, Konstantīns Beņkovskis has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 203 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in General Economics, Econometrics and Finance, 15 papers in Strategy and Management and 13 papers in Economics and Econometrics. Recurrent topics in Konstantīns Beņkovskis’s work include Global trade and economics (19 papers), Global Trade and Competitiveness (13 papers) and International Business and FDI (10 papers). Konstantīns Beņkovskis is often cited by papers focused on Global trade and economics (19 papers), Global Trade and Competitiveness (13 papers) and International Business and FDI (10 papers). Konstantīns Beņkovskis collaborates with scholars based in Austria, France and Estonia. Konstantīns Beņkovskis's co-authors include Julia Wörz, Naomitsu Yashiro, Priit Vahter, Jaan Masso, Julia Woerz, Maria Antoinette Silgoner, Elena Bobeica, Chiara Osbat, Stefan Zeugner and Samuel Hurtado and has published in prestigious journals such as Economic Modelling, Economic Policy and Journal of Productivity Analysis.
